Why Your Website Isn't Booking Clients (And How to Fix It)

Affiliate Discloser Statement: This post may contain affiliate links, which means I may earn a commission if you purchase through my links, at no additional cost to you. But don’t worry, I only share stuff I love and use myself!

Your services are outstanding and your website is up and running, and now you are anticipating a flood of new clients. But as for you, instead of a packed schedule, you’re hearing crickets. What gives?

If your website isn’t converting visitors into booked clients, you’re not alone. This is exactly the problem that many small business owners encounter. The good news? It’s fixable. Let’s break down the most common reasons your website isn’t working for you—and how to turn it into a client-booking machine.

1. There Is No Visible Calls-to-Action (CTA) on Your Website

People will not act when they do not know the action you want them to take. If your website has no visible strong CTAs or they are hidden in the fine print, the potential clients will leave without ever taking the next step.

How to Fix It:

Some of the best CTAs include; Request a Free Consultation, Begin Your Project, or Get Your Quote.

Make sure CTAs are easy to find—place them on your homepage, service pages, and even within your blog posts.

With Monday.com, we can track client inquiries and automate follow-ups so no lead gets away from us.

2. The Current Booking Process Is Complex

If the booking process is too complicated for the potential clients, they will drop the process before completing it. It could be a complex contact form, several processes, or the absence of the ability to schedule on the fly that may discourage people.

How to Fix It:

Tools like Calendly or Acuity Scheduling enable clients to schedule meetings with you at their own convenient time.

Reduce unnecessary form fields—only ask for essential information.

With Dubsado automate client onboarding and ensure that all operations are streamlined and organized.

3. Your Website Does Not Inspire Confidence

If the potential customers are not confident in your ability, they will not book. Lack of social proof, a poor design, or missing key credibility elements may lead to people’s hesitation.

How to Fix It:

Request feedback from previous clients and display the feedback on your website.

Include the company’s case studies or a portfolio of work done.

Emphasize certifications, awards, or media mentions.

Shopify is great for selling services or digital products and will make sure that the buying process is as smooth and professional as possible.

4. Your Website Takes Too Long to Load

This is according to OptinMonster, 40% of users will bounce off a website that takes more than three seconds to load. If your site is slow, then your potential clients will not have the patience to book with you.

How to Fix It:

This ensures that images are optimized and that a caching plugin is used.

Choose a reliable hosting provider.

Remove all unnecessary scripts and plugins.

4. You Don’t Apply SEO to Attract the Right Clients

Even the best-designed website won’t book clients if no one can find it. Lack of proper SEO (Search Engine Optimization) could mean that your business is hidden under your competitors in Google search results.

How to Fix It:

Use keyword research tools to discover what your target audience is searching for.

Optimize your service pages and blog content for the keywords you have identified.

Blog consistently! Provide solutions to client problems and demonstrate expertise.

If you own an e-commerce store then you can use Shopify’s built-in SEO tools to optimize product pages.

6. You’re Not Nurturing Leads

It is not possible to book every visitor who comes to your site. This is because, without a system to follow up with potential clients, you are losing out on business.

How to Fix It:

Develop a lead magnet, for instance, a checklist or a guide to capture the leads.

Use Klaviyo or Flodesk to set up an email nurture sequence to keep in touch.

7. Your Pricing Is Unclear (Or Too Hidden)

If clients cannot find the prices on the site, they may think that the services are expensive or get annoyed and leave.

How to Fix It:

If possible, it is better to display the prices openly, or at least give some approximate costs.

Offer detailed package options.

In case of a custom price, it should be possible to request a quote without a lot of hassle.

Turn Your Website into a Client-Booking Powerhouse

Your website should work for you, not against you. By implementing these changes, you’ll create a seamless experience for visitors, build trust, and increase bookings.

Ready to make your website work for you? Start with one of these fixes today and watch your client bookings grow!

Previous
Previous

Signs It's Time to Level Up Your Business Systems

Next
Next

The Best Tools for Creative Entrepreneurs in 2025